1 O someday, with trump of God and a shout,
And sound of the archangel's voice,
From Heaven the Lord Himself shall descend:
So let us be glad and rejoice.
Chorus:
Then oh, what delight when faith shall be sight
And Jesus comes back for His own;
Caught up in the air, to be with Him there,
O quickly, Lord Jesus, so come!
2 On that day the dead in Christ shall rise first,
And those of His own who remain
Together with Him shall meet in the clouds
Without any dying or pain. [Chorus]
3 Then sorrow we not as those without hope,
But comfort ourselves with this word,
That all those in Him, when He shall return,
Forever shall be with the Lord. [Chorus]
